Top Ten Tourist Attractions in Shanxi
1, Yungang Grottoes in Datong: It is one of the largest grottoes in China, and it is also called the four artistic treasures of China with Dunhuang Mogao Grottoes, Luoyang Longmen Grottoes and Maijishan Grottoes. It is carved along the mountain and stretches for about one kilometer from east to west. Magnificent and rich in content, it is the first classic masterpiece of Buddhist art in China.
2. Pingyao Ancient City: With a history of more than 2,700 years, it is a city living between history and modernity. It has been listed in the World Cultural Heritage List, and retains the architectural features of the Ming and Qing Dynasties. It is one of the four existing ancient cities in China.
3. Hanging Temple: Located on the cliff of Mianshan Mountain, it is famous for its peculiar cantilever structure. It is the largest and most intact ancient cantilever building in China.
4. Wutai Mountain: Together with Putuo Mountain in Zhejiang, Jiuhua Mountain in Anhui and Emei Mountain in Sichuan, it is known as the four famous Buddhist mountains in China. It is known as the first Buddhist forest in the East, with numerous temples, magnificent momentum and beautiful scenery.
Hukou Waterfall: Hukou Waterfall in the upper reaches of the Yellow River is the second largest waterfall in China and the largest yellow waterfall in the world. Magnificent, magnificent, is an excellent performance of natural landscape.
6. Jinci Temple: One of the four ancestral temples in China, it is a place to commemorate Yan Hui, a disciple of Confucius, and has a strong historical and cultural heritage.
